PageVisitorsRule Veri Nesnesi - Kampanya Yönetimi
Sayfa ziyaretçilerinin yeniden pazarlama kuralını tanımlar.
Yeniden pazarlama kuralları, yeniden pazarlama listenize kimlerin ekleneceğini belirlemek için kullanılan koşullardır. PageVisitors kuralı için bir veya daha fazla kural öğesi grubu eklemeniz gerekir.
Önemli
2021 takvim yılı boyunca konjonktif normal form (CNF) desteği ekledik. Daha önce Microsoft Advertising yalnızca ayrık normal formu (DNF) destekliyordu. Yeni sayfa ziyaretçi kuralı için varsayılan normal form DNF olarak kalır. Ancak, uygulamanızın CNF ve DNF'yi uygun şekilde okuyup ayırt etmesini sağlamanız gerekir. Uygulamanız artık kuralın ayrık olduğunu varsaymamalıdır.
Normal form konjonktürel (CNF) ise, ilk olarak mantıksal OR işleci kullanılarak aynı sayfaya ait kural öğesi koşulları birleştirilir. Ardından, kural öğesi grupları listesindeki her sonuç mantıksal AND işleci kullanılarak birleştirilir. Başka bir deyişle, tüm kural öğesi gruplarında belirtilen kural öğesi koşullarından herhangi biri karşılanırsa kullanıcı yeniden pazarlama listenize eklenir.
Normal form ayrık ise (DNF), ilk olarak mantıksal AND işleci kullanılarak aynı sayfaya ait kural öğesi koşulları birleştirilir. Ardından, kural öğesi grupları listesindeki her sonuç mantıksal OR işleci kullanılarak birleştirilir. Başka bir deyişle, kural öğesi gruplarından herhangi birinde belirtilen tüm kural öğesi koşulları karşılanırsa kullanıcı yeniden pazarlama listenize eklenir.
Ayrıntılı bir örnek için aşağıdaki Açıklamalar bölümüne bakın.
Sözdizimi
<xs:complexType name="PageVisitorsRule"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<xs:complexContent mixed="false">
<xs:extension base="tns:RemarketingRule">
<xs:sequence>
<xs:element minOccurs="0" name="NormalForm" nillable="true" type="tns:NormalForm">
<xs:annotation>
<xs:appinfo>
<DefaultValue EmitDefaultValue="false" xmlns="http://schemas.microsoft.com/2003/10/Serialization/" />
</xs:appinfo>
</xs:annotation>
</xs:element>
<xs:element minOccurs="0" name="RuleItemGroups" nillable="true" type="tns:ArrayOfRuleItemGroup" />
</xs:sequence>
</xs:extension>
</xs:complexContent>
</xs:complexType>
Öğe
PageVisitorsRule nesnesi şu öğelere sahiptir: NormalForm, RuleItemGroups.
Öğe | Açıklama | Veri Türü |
---|---|---|
NormalForm | Kural öğesi gruplarının konjonktif normal forma (CNF) veya ayrık normal biçime (DNF) göre değerlendirilip değerlendirilmediğini belirler. Bu öğe varsayılan olarak döndürülmedi. Bu öğeyi almak için, GetAudiencesByIds hizmeti işlemini çağırdığınızda ReturnAdditionalFields öğesine NormalForm değerini ekleyin. Ekle: Isteğe bağlı. Varsayılan değer "Ayrık"tır. Güncelleştirme: Isteğe bağlı |
NormalForm |
RuleItemGroups | Yeniden pazarlama listesine uygulanmasını istediğiniz kural öğesi gruplarının listesi. Bu öğedeki kural öğesi grubu sayısı üst sınırı 100'dür. Kural öğesi grubu başına en fazla kural öğesi sayısı 100'dür. Ekle: Gerekli Güncelleştirme: Gerekli. Önceki kural öğesi gruplarından herhangi birini korumak istiyorsanız, güncelleştirme sırasında bunları açıkça yeniden ayarlamanız gerekir. |
RuleItemGroup dizisi |
PageVisitorsRule nesnesinin Devralınan Öğeleri vardır.
Devralınan Öğeler
RemarketingRule'dan Devralınan Öğeler
PageVisitorsRule nesnesi RemarketingRule nesnesinden türetilir ve aşağıdaki öğeleri devralır: Tür. Aşağıdaki açıklamalar PageVisitorsRule'a özeldir ve RemarketingRule nesnesinden aynı öğeleri devralan diğer nesneler için geçerli olmayabilir.
Öğe | Açıklama | Veri Türü |
---|---|---|
Tür | Yeniden pazarlama kuralının türü. Yeniden pazarlama kuralı türleri hakkında daha fazla bilgi için bkz. RemarketingRule Veri Nesnesi Açıklamaları. Ekle: Salt okunur Güncelleştirme: Salt okunur |
Dize |
Açıklamalar
Yeniden pazarlama kuralları, yeniden pazarlama listenize kimlerin ekleneceğini belirlemek için kullanılan koşullardır. PageVisitors kuralı için bir veya daha fazla kural öğesi grubu eklemeniz gerekir.
Önemli
2021 takvim yılı boyunca konjonktif normal form (CNF) desteği ekledik. Daha önce Microsoft Advertising yalnızca ayrık normal formu (DNF) destekliyordu. Yeni sayfa ziyaretçi kuralı için varsayılan normal form DNF olarak kalır. Ancak, uygulamanızın CNF ve DNF'yi uygun şekilde okuyup ayırt etmesini sağlamanız gerekir. Uygulamanız artık kuralın ayrık olduğunu varsaymamalıdır.
Normal form konjonktürel (CNF) ise, ilk olarak mantıksal OR işleci kullanılarak aynı sayfaya ait kural öğesi koşulları birleştirilir. Ardından, kural öğesi grupları listesindeki her sonuç mantıksal AND işleci kullanılarak birleştirilir. Başka bir deyişle, tüm kural öğesi gruplarında belirtilen kural öğesi koşullarından herhangi biri karşılanırsa kullanıcı yeniden pazarlama listenize eklenir.
Normal form ayrık ise (DNF), ilk olarak mantıksal AND işleci kullanılarak aynı sayfaya ait kural öğesi koşulları birleştirilir. Ardından, kural öğesi grupları listesindeki her sonuç mantıksal OR işleci kullanılarak birleştirilir. Başka bir deyişle, kural öğesi gruplarından herhangi birinde belirtilen tüm kural öğesi koşulları karşılanırsa kullanıcı yeniden pazarlama listenize eklenir.
Ayrık normal form değerlendirmesi örneği için aşağıdaki kural öğesi gruplarının ayarlandığını düşünelim.
<Rule i:type="PageVisitorsRule">
<Type i:nil="true" />
<NormalForm i:nil="true" />
<RuleItemGroups>
<RuleItemGroup>
<Items>
<RuleItem i:type="StringRuleItem">
<Type i:nil="true" />
<Operand>Url</Operand>
<Operator>Contains</Operator>
<Value>X</Value>
</RuleItem>
<RuleItem i:type="StringRuleItem">
<Type i:nil="true" />
<Operand>ReferrerUrl</Operand>
<Operator>DoesNotContain</Operator>
<Value>Z</Value>
</RuleItem>
</Items>
</RuleItemGroup>
<RuleItemGroup>
<Items>
<RuleItem i:type="StringRuleItem">
<Type i:nil="true" />
<Operand>Url</Operand>
<Operator>DoesNotBeginWith</Operator>
<Value>Y</Value>
</RuleItem>
</Items>
</RuleItemGroup>
<RuleItemGroup>
<Items>
<RuleItem i:type="StringRuleItem">
<Type i:nil="true" />
<Operand>ReferrerUrl</Operand>
<Operator>Equals</Operator>
<Value>Z</Value>
</RuleItem>
</Items>
</RuleItemGroup>
</RuleItemGroups>
</Rule>
Yukarıdaki tanım aşağıdaki mantıksal ifadeye çevrilir:
((Url X içerir) ve (ReferrerUrl DoesNotContain Z)) veya ((Url DoesNotBeginWith Y)) veya ((ReferrerUrl Eşittir Z))
Mantıksal ifadenin değerlendirilmesi, aşağıdaki örnek kullanıcılardan hangisinin yeniden pazarlama listesine ekleneceğini belirler.
Kullanıcı | Url Ziyaret Edildi | Başvuran Url'si | Listeye Eklendi |
---|---|---|---|
Kullanıcı 1 | A |
X | Evet. Mantıksal ifade sonuçlarının True olarak değerlendirilmesi. ((Url X içerir) ve (ReferrerUrl DoesNotContain Z)) veya ((Url DoesNotBeginWith Y)) veya ((ReferrerUrl Eşittir Z)) (Yanlış ve Doğru) veya (Doğru) veya (Yanlış) Yanlış, Doğru veya Yanlış True |
Kullanıcı 2 | B |
E | Hayır. Mantıksal ifade sonuçlarının False olarak değerlendirilmesi. ((Url X içerir) ve (ReferrerUrl DoesNotContain Z)) veya ((Url DoesNotBeginWith Y)) veya ((ReferrerUrl Eşittir Z)) (Yanlış ve Doğru) veya (Yanlış) veya (Yanlış) Yanlış veya Yanlış ya da Yanlış False |
Kullanıcı 3 | C |
Z | Evet. Mantıksal ifade sonuçlarının True olarak değerlendirilmesi. ((Url X içerir) ve (ReferrerUrl DoesNotContain Z)) veya ((Url DoesNotBeginWith Y)) veya ((ReferrerUrl Eşittir Z)) (Yanlış ve Yanlış) veya (Doğru) veya (Doğru) Yanlış, Doğru veya Doğru True |
Gereksinimler
Hizmet: CampaignManagementService.svc v13
Ad alanı: https://bingads.microsoft.com/CampaignManagement/v13